Switching Between Applications when using Full Screen Resolution
The Apple taskbar will be hidden when running the ESP client in full screen
resolution mode. Use the two left-most bottom keys to reveal the Apple taskbar.
Changing the Screen Resolution and Colours on a Macintosh
- Run the ‘Citrix ICA Client Editor’ from the ICAMAC folder on your hard
drive.
- Use the ‘File’ menu and ‘Open’ the file called ‘ESP’ which is on your
desktop. However, if you have moved the ‘ESP’ file to another location, for
example your ‘Apple Menu’ then you will have to open it from your ‘Apple Menu’ .
- Change the drop down menu from ‘Network Connection’ to ‘Window’ .
- Specify the Screen Resolution and Colour Resolution of your choice.
- Select ‘Save’ and then ‘Quit’.
- Restart the ESP connection and trial the new resolution and colour
combination.
How to stop the request for access prompts
- Run the ‘Citrix ICA Client Editor’ from the ICAMAC folder on your hard
drive.
- From the options menu select 'Default Settings'.
- Change the drop down menu from ‘Window’ to ‘Drive Mapping’.
- You will notice the MAC hard disk ('untitled') has a pair of glasses and a
pencial against it. By clicking on these images you can disbale (a cross appears
through the image), prompt (a question mark appears through the image) or
enable.

(NOTE: If you decide to disable access to your MAC hard disk then you will
not be able to use the download button in ESP Report Viewer.)
What to do if you get - Sorry the connection to ESP was broken
- Run the ‘Citrix ICA Client Editor’ from the ICAMAC folder on your hard
drive.
- From the options menu select 'Default Settings'.
- Change the drop down menu from ‘Window’ to ‘Preferences’.
- In the 'Server Browser Address' type 'esp1.anu.edu.au'.
- Ensure that the boxes are checked for all three options (Enable Windows
Alert Sounds, Enable ICA Client Auto Quit, Allow Automatic Client Updates).
Configuring MacOS X client for connection to ESP
- Run MacICA_OSX.dmg.
- Open the Citrix ICA Client
- Run the Citrix ICA Client Editor
- Accept the license agreement
- Under Connection select Server
- Under Connect to: enter esp1.anu.edu.au
- Leave protocol as TCP/IP+HTTP
- Under Conneciton Properties select Window Colors of Millions
- Save the connection details
